In a whirlwind of unhinged experimentation, Matt DeMello's B-sides collection transforms Sublime into doo-wop and LCD Soundsystem into saloon piano romps, while Eversame delivers refined shoegaze with screamo undertones. The Darts rage against the machine with anarchic fury, as Stress Dolls channel Jimmy Eat World-esque yearning. Tiberius crafts self-dubbed 'Farm Emo' while Jeremy Abrams wraps anxiety in infectious pop-punk hooks.
